On average across the year,
yes, Australia is hotter than
Eugene, Oregon
.
Australia has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F and Eugene, Oregon has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F.
Australia's hottest month is January,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F, which is not hotter than Eugene, Oregon's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).
On average across the year, no, Australia is not colder than Eugene, Oregon . Australia has an average minimum temperature of 13°C/55°F and Eugene, Oregon has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F.
On average across the year,
no, Australia has less rain than
Eugene, Oregon. Australia has an average annual rainfall of 899mm and Eugene, Oregon has an average annual rainfall of 979mm.
Australia's wettest month is January, with an average monthly rainfall of 116mm, which is drier than Eugene, Oregon's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 180mm).
